| |
Kodowane znaki: ASCII(0)-ASCII(255).
Długość kodu: zmienna, do 1914 znaków bajtowych, do 3067 znaków alfabetycznych lub do 3832 cyfr (przy rekomendowanym poziomie korekcji błędów 23%).
|

ABCDEFGHabcdefgh1234567890
Przykład wygenerował program
|
Aztec jest kodem dwuwymiarowym o dużej gęstości. Kodowane mogą być wszystkie znaki ASCII (0-255).
Kod zbudowany jest na kwadratowej siatce z tarczą na środku. Dane są kodowane jako warstwy otaczające tarczę. Każda kolejna warstwa całkowicie otacza poprzednią. W ten sposób kod się rozrasta.
Kodowane mogą być zarówno krótki wiadomości jak i bardzo długie. Kod może być skanowany w dowolnej orientacji. Kod Aztec posiada mechanizm poprawiania (korekcji) błędów.
|
Najmniejszy element w kodzie Aztec nazywany jest "modułem" (kwadrat). Wielkość modułu i poziom korekcji błędów są jedynymi parametrami określanymi przez użytkownika. Zalecane jest, aby wielkość modułu była z przedziału od 0.015 do 0.020 cala, a poziom korekcji błędów na poziomie 23%, żeby kod był odczytywany przez większość czytników.
Wielkość kodu Aztec zależy od wielkości modułu, ilości zakodowanych znaków oraz od poziomu korekcji błędów określonego przez użytkownika. Najmniejszy kod jest kwadratem o wymiarach 15x15 modułów i może zakodować do 13 cyfr lub 12 znaków alfabetycznych z 23% korekcją błędów. Największy symbol może mieć wymiary 151x151 modułów.
Czarny kwadratowy obszar interpretowany jest jako binarna wartość 1, a jasny jako binarne 0. Nie jest wymagana cicha strefa wokół kodu. Korekcja błędów jest ustalana przez użytkownika i może być na poziomie od 5% do 95% (zalecany poziom 23%).
|
|
Najważniejszymi zaletami kodu Aztec są: duża swoboda w ilości i rodzaju kodowanych danych oraz korekcja błędów. Stosowany jest do oznaczania i śledzenia kuponów konkursowych w akcjach promocyjnych.
|
|
|